A cutaway view of a modern heat pump, which is used for heating and cooling homes efficiently. The unit features a large fan at the top, responsible for drawing air across the heat exchanger coils. Inside, you can see copper refrigerant lines, a red compressor, and electrical components that regulate its operation. The system works by transferring heat between the indoors and outdoors, using refrigerant to absorb and release thermal energy. The insulated coil on the right helps improve heat exchange efficiency, reducing energy consumption. Heat pumps are a popular choice for homeowners due to their ability to provide year-round climate control. Their energy efficiency makes them a sustainable alternative to traditional HVAC systems.
